Awesome! How long did you wear the compression garnents? When did you notice the biggest changes in the swelling going down? Thanks for sharing... :)
My doctor told me I could stop wearing my compression garment at 6 weeks but I felt too naked without the support so I kept it on for 8 weeks just during the day. At night I would just wear regular underwear. I then went out to Walmart and purchased those cheap support underwear to wear during the day without my binder. They are a tiny bit snug but not too tight just enough to keep me comfortable then I just wear regular underwear at night. I am noticing now that some of the swelling is down in the morning but but the afternoon I still swell a bit. The doctor said the swelling could last six months or more.
Loose clothes are your friend right now. My CG and zippers/hooks in front, on each side, with hole in crotch for goin to the bathroom. I wore underwear over top of mine. Had to take th CG off to go poo. Sounds like you're gonna need help in that department, cause of the way yours is constructed. Foam pads help make the Lipo areas to heal flat, so try and be patient with that. Best wishes for a speedy recovery. :-DSzuy

Hey there. Hope you're doing well with the TT recovery. Got a question for you about your arm lift recovery. When did you start using the silicone strips? I think I read where you stopped at 12 weeks, but didn't see when you started. Think I'm ready for them. I'm 3 weeks post op, and my incisions look like yours did at that point. Thanks and continued good healing :-DSuzy
I started around 3 weeks, my doctor is the one who told me when to start, he already mentioned he expects me start that on my TT incision in two weeks.
Great! Thanks so much. I already gave the strips. I used them with my TT and I really think they help make the incision/scar minimal and flat. I had a few little scabby/slightly open spots on tummy so had to wait til 6 weeks to start with the silicone. My arms look all closed, so gonna go ahead and start. Thanks again.
